About Wen-Ching Lin

Wen-Ching Lin is a scholar working on Information Systems, Artificial Intelligence and Hardware and Architecture, having authored 21 papers that have together received 346 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Coding theory and cryptography (12 papers), Cryptography and Residue Arithmetic (12 papers) and Cryptography and Data Security (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Information Systems (204 citations), Artificial Intelligence (249 citations) and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(26 citations). Wen-Ching Lin has collaborated with scholars based in Taiwan and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Ming‐Der Shieh, Alex Guazzelli, M. Zeller, Junhong Chen, Junhong Chen, Michael R. Berthold, Junhong Chen, Chien‐Ming Wu, Yun Mou and Yi‐Chung Pan.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Computers, IEEE Internet of Things Journal and EMBO Molecular Medicine.
